探秘新青app:程序专业开发的背后!

作者:邯郸麻将开发公司 阅读:10 次 发布时间:2025-07-10 06:24:37

摘要:本文将探讨新青app的开发,以及程序专业开发的背后。首先了解了解新青app的概况,其次介绍了现代软件开发的一般过程。接着,我们将深入探讨软件开发的技术层面,具体涉及了现代软件的架构、技术选择以及相关工具和测试等方面。最后,我们将探讨新青app的可持续发展,以及程序员的角色和职责等问题。1....

  本文将探讨新青app的开发,以及程序专业开发的背后。首先了解了解新青app的概况,其次介绍了现代软件开发的一般过程。接着,我们将深入探讨软件开发的技术层面,具体涉及了现代软件的架构、技术选择以及相关工具和测试等方面。最后,我们将探讨新青app的可持续发展,以及程序员的角色和职责等问题。

探秘新青app:程序专业开发的背后!

  1. 新青app的概况

  新青app是一款致力于为青年人服务的互联网平台,旨在为广大青年用户提供全方位的学习、咨询和娱乐服务。它是由一家名为新青科技的公司所推出,并且得到了不少用户的认可和喜爱。

  2. 现代软件开发的一般过程

  如今,软件开发已经成为了一项复杂且具有挑战性的任务。现代软件开发的过程通常包含以下步骤:

  2.1. 需求分析

  在进行任何软件开发之前,我们必须先认真考虑和评估用户的需求。这通常需要我们与客户进行交流、讨论和协商,以更准确地理解他们的具体需求和期望。

  2.2. 设计

  设计是软件开发过程中非常重要的一个节点。在这个步骤中,我们需要考虑所需的功能、数据结构、程序逻辑、界面和用户体验等方面。设计的目标是创建一个高效、稳定和易于使用的软件系统。

  2.3. 编码

  编码是软件开发的核心工作,程序员使用各种编程语言和技术来实现软件系统的功能。编码阶段需要程序员遵循编码规范和最佳实践,确保生成的代码是高效、可读性强、易于维护和扩展等。

  2.4. 测试

  软件开发的测试阶段是非常重要的。目的是确保系统可以正常运行,符合用户需求和标准,达到设定的质量要求。测试阶段涵盖了很多方面,如单元测试、功能测试、性能测试、安全测试等等。

  2.5. 部署

  一旦软件系统经过测试和验证符合实际要求之后,部署工作就可以开始了。这可能包括安装、配置、优化、和测试等步骤,确保软件能够正常运行

  3. 程序开发的技术层面

  在程序开发的技术层面上,我们需要决策系统架构、技术和工具的选择,下面我们将重点解释这些技术。

  3.1. 前端技术

  前端技术涉及到任何直接和用户界面有关的方面。这包括HTML、CSS、JavaScript、React等等。对于新青app而言,前端技术的选择对用户体验至关重要。

  3.2. 后端技术

  后端技术指的是与服务端相关的技术,常用的如Springboot、Django、Ruby等框架。后端技术的选择涉及到数据存储、处理与部署。例如,为了满足大量用户访问新青app的需求,我们会选择负载均衡技术和数据库分片技术等等。

  3.3. 数据库技术

  常用的关系型数据库技术有MySQL、Oracle等,非关系型数据库有MongoDB、Redis等。对于新青app的数据库设计,需要通盘考虑存储和查询的效率和安全性。

  3.4. 云服务技术

  使用云服务技术可以加速系统部署过程并提高服务器可用性,这也是新青app采用的技术之一。阿里云、腾讯云等云服务商提供了可靠和高效的云计算服务。

  3.5. 安全问题

  在新青app中,安全是一个关键问题。系统中的用户数据、交易数据、行为数据都需要进行保护。保障安全需要考虑各种安全措施,加密和认证技术、访问控制、审计、恢复等等。

  4. 新青app的可持续发展

  在新青app的可持续发展上,程序员的职责也非常重要。程序员需要主动关注业务发展新动向和用户反馈,跟进用户需求和维护系统稳定性。同时,还要对产品安全和容错特性进行持续优化,实现产品高可靠的运行。

  在新青app开发过程中,程序专业开发的核心不仅在于技术方面的选择,而在于团队精神和合作。软件开发过程中需要各专业的协同,团队中每个角色都承担着不同的职责。程序员要承担的责任更多还要在维护和管理的角度思考系统性问题。这个责任要求开发人员提高创新和解决问题的能力。

  本文将为大家带来新青app的探秘,介绍该app由程序专业开发人员开发的背景、主要功能以及各种技术细节。在本文中,您将了解到新青app背后的故事、技术团队的结构、开发过程中遇到的挑战以及未来的发展趋势。

  1. 起源与背景

  新青app诞生于2017年,是一款由青年创新创业联盟(即CEC青年创新创业俱乐部)与深圳前海青年创业园共同打造的移动应用。作为一个青年创新创业平台,新青app旨在为广大青年提供一个交流、创作、学习与分享的平台。新青app在创意展示、创新创业、互动交流等方面都有着独特、优秀的设计理念和功能。

  新青app的开发团队由一群程序开发人员组成,他们都具备着良好的编码习惯、丰富的行业经验和敬业精神。在新青app的开发中,他们面临了诸多技术挑战,但是在团队的共同努力下,最终实现了新青app的开发目标。下面,我们将深入了解新青app的开发过程和技术细节。

  2. 技术团队的结构

  新青app的技术团队由一名技术负责人和若干程序开发人员组成,其中技术负责人负责项目的整体管理和技术方案制定,程序开发人员负责实现技术方案并提供技术支持。所有的技术开发都要团队成员的代码审核和集成测试。

  新青app的技术团队采用Scrum敏捷开发方法,将整个开发过程分解成若干时间段(Sprint),并每次通过项目周报的形式给出开发进度和问题跟踪报告。

  3. 开发过程中的挑战

  在新青app的开发中,技术团队面临了许多挑战。其中最大的难点是如何兼顾速度和质量。为了提高开发效率,团队采用了一些自动化工具和应用程序接口(API)。在对新功能进行测试时,他们也使用了自动化测试工具来提高测试效率并避免常见的BUG。

  另外,新青app的开发还涉及到了多平台的适配和兼容性问题。它需要在iOS和Android系统上运行,并且需要适配多种屏幕分辨率、多种设备型号以及各种网络环境。因此,技术团队需要做充分的测试来保证新青app的稳定性和适应性。

  4. 技术细节

  新青app在技术方面也有一些比较独特的设计。首先,新青app的用户权限管理采用了RBAC(Role-Based Access Control)模型,即基于角色的访问控制模型。这是一种灵活而可扩展的访问控制模型,它能够根据不同用户和角色的访问需求来设置访问权限。

  另外,新青app的后台架构采用了Spring Boot框架,这是一个高效、简洁、易维护的Java后台框架,其集成了众多的Spring组件,如Spring MVC和Spring Security等,在自动配置、监控、性能等方面也提供了很好的支持。在前端方面,新青app采用了React Native框架,这是一种基于ReactJS库的跨平台移动应用开发框架。它支持JavaScript语言的开发,具有很好的跨平台性和可拓展性。

  5. 未来发展趋势

  新青app的未来发展有着无限的可能。它可以通过多种方式提高用户参与度和活跃度,如推出更多丰富多彩的活动、优化用户界面、实现更好的用户个性化推荐等。随着技术的不断推进,新青app也可以通过引入新技术来提高其用户体验和品牌价值。

  总结:本文详细介绍了新青app的背景与起源、技术团队的结构以及开发过程中遇到的挑战。同时,我们也了解到了新青app在技术方面的一些独特设计和技术细节。无论是现在还是未来,新青app都将源源不断地为广大青年提供优质、高效的创新创业服务。

  • 原标题:探秘新青app:程序专业开发的背后!

  • 本文链接:https://qipaikaifa.cn/qpzx/349498.html

  • 本文由邯郸麻将开发公司中天华智网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与中天华智网联系删除。
  • 微信二维码

    ZTHZ2028

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:157-1842-0347


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部